Proofpoint
Enterprise email security platform covering gateway and API protection, DMARC enforcement, and account takeover defense.
Technical Architecture & Overview
Proofpoint offers Core Email Protection deployable as a gateway or through API, Email Fraud Defense for DMARC and lookalike domain monitoring, Account Takeover Protection, and Adaptive Email DLP. It is a Leader in the 2025 Gartner Magic Quadrant for Email Security and remains a default choice in large enterprise mail security reviews. Detection combines global threat telemetry with per-customer policy.
Targeted Technical Use Cases
Large organizations with targeted attack risk that need mail security plus brand and identity protection in one vendor.
Evaluation & Trade-offs
Core Strengths
- +Extensive threat intelligence network.
- +Identity and domain defense alongside message filtering.
- +Mature admin and compliance tooling.
Trade-Offs & Limitations
- -Premium tiers needed for the full feature set.
- -Enterprise pricing and onboarding effort.
Defensive Security Application
Stopping targeted phishing, spoofed domains, and compromised accounts in enterprise mail flows.
